CYCLING
YOUTH BICYCLISTS OF NEVADA COUNTY
(YBONC): Provides cycling support for youth,
works with school bike clubs. Holds events
like Dirt Classic XC Series, Miners Dirt Series,
Bike Safety Rodeo and Take a Kid Mountain
Biking Day. Information: ybonc.org
